Hardwood Floor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ak with minimal damage Yes No You can likely fix the leak and dry out the area on your own.
Large flood with extensive damage No Yes You’ll need specialized equipment and expertise to restore your hardwood floors to their original condition.
Uncertain about the extent of the damage No Yes A professional will be able to ass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your hardwood floors.
Time-sensitive situation (e.g. Before a big event) No Yes A professional will be able to work quickly and efficiently to get your hardwood floors restored in no time.
Concerned about health and safety risks No Yes A professional will be able to identify and address any potential health and safety risks associated with water damage.
Worried about the cost No Yes A professional will be able to help you navigate the insurance process and get the compensation you deserve.

Hardwood Floor Water Extraction Cost In Newcastle, WA

The cost of Hardwood Floor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Newcastle, WA.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to address it.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ed
Inspection and Repair $100 – $500 The extent of the damage and the type of repairs needed
Equipment Rental $50 – $200 The type and duration of equipment rental
Travel Fees $50 – $200 The distance to and from the job site
Materials and Supplies $100 – $500 The type and quantity of materials needed

How do I prevent water damage from happening in the future?

There are several steps you can take to prevent water damage from happening in the future. These include checking your home’s plumbing system regularly, fixing leaks quickly, and installing a sump pump or other water mitigation system.
